Akai Fleming, a freshman guard, is set to join the Cincinnati Bearcats after completing a season with the Georgia Tech Yellow Jackets in the Atlantic Coast Conference.
During that campaign he posted averages of 10.4 points, 3.2 rebounds and 1.3 assists per game, while shooting 37.3 % from the field and 32.9 % from three‑point range.

Coach Jerrod Calhoun has highlighted Fleming’s scoring instincts and defensive versatility, noting that the young player brings valuable experience from a high‑level conference.
Ranked as the nation’s No. 101 prospect in the 2025 class and No. 30 among shooting guards in the transfer portal, Fleming also logged a 5.9 Game Score metric according to analyst John Hollinger.
His season‑high of 19 points came in narrow defeats to Cal and Stanford, underscoring both his potential and the areas where he can still grow.
While his shooting splits and relative youth suggest room for development, the influx of additional talent at Cincinnati is expected to lessen the early‑season pressure on the freshman.
